Bank Zero is reshaping banking in South Africa with a 100% app-based platform, promising zero monthly fees and high-level digital security. Individuals and business owners can open and manage accounts entirely via their smartphones. While there is no physical branch, users get access to one of the lowest-fee, hands-on digital banking solutions now available in the country.
The interest rates on savings or everyday transactional accounts vary depending on account usage and global rates; there are typically no monthly banking charges, and many local payments are processed for free. Bank Zero operates with transparent pricing, zero surprise debit orders, and powerful app-based controls for both personal and business customers.
How to Apply for a Bank Zero Account
- Download the Bank Zero app from the Apple App Store or Google Play Store.
- Register your profile in under 5 minutes with your South African ID and a selfie for digital FICA verification.
- Create a personal account (required for all users).
- To open a business account, use the app to add your business details and upload supporting documents as directed.
- Order your personalised debit card through the app, which will be delivered to your door.
Pros of Banking with Bank Zero
The first major advantage is the cost-saving: zero monthly fees for both individuals and businesses, and extremely low transaction costs for local payments. Users enjoy enhanced security, including protection against fraudulent transactions and card skimming, thanks to patent-pending technology, 3DS authentication, and real-time app alerts.
Bank Zero is also highly user-oriented, with features like shared accounts, downloadable statements straight into Excel, flexible authorisation chains for business, and easy integration with tools like Xero for seamless accounting.
Cons of Banking with Bank Zero
The major drawback for some users is the lack of physical branches or in-person customer support. All services and assistance are accessed through the app or online channels, which may not suit everyone.
Another consideration is that cash deposits might be less convenient, as you must use partner ATMs or retail outlets, potentially leading to extra fees in those scenarios.
